Background qCompletion of the 1st Phase of NGIS Project l Establish geo-spatial database since ‘95 l Complete nationwide digital mapping 1:1,000, 1:5,000, 1:25,000 qFully support data utilization l Maximizing data sharing Standardization Building high speed data network l Establish mechanism for effective data updating By major users : municipalities, agencies, etc.

4 1.1 Strategies for NGIS Establishing national geospatial information infrastructure Developing GIS utilization /distribution systems Establishment of Digital Land Establishment framework database Establishment of Clearing house Promotion of GIS industries Development of Human Resources Technology development GIS utilization Standardization of GI R & D/Institutional framework Public GIS Private GIS E-daily life

nd master plan of NGIS qPeriod : 2001 ~ 2005 qMain Objective : GIS data utilization l Develop national framework database l Develop clearinghouse Create mechanism to ensure adequate management Distributing and sharing of the spatial data l Develop strategy for updating data l Develop GIS technology l Training GIS specialists l Promote public and private partnership

Pilot project qPurpose l Develop clearinghouse technology l Select best-fit system for our locality qPeriod : July, 2000 ~ June, 2001 qMajor contents l Developing a pilot system l Test data Topography, Land use, Forest map, Land cover, etc. qParticipants l Ministry of Environment, National Geography Institute l Korea Forest Service, Rural Development Administration l Incheon Metropolitan City

Pilot network Gateway (Administration) MOCT Data provider(Node)  NGI / MOE  KFS / RDA  Incheon city Bank User Private sectorPublic sector Internet

Major output qBeginning the service l 2 May, 2001 qParticipating agencies l 10 agencies qHomepage l URL: qLanguage l English version being developed qAvailable modes l User mode l Administration mode l Data provider mode

Main project qObjectives l Establishing nationwide geo-spatial information network l Supplementing pilot project results l Provide better quality and quantity of the data l Establishing a organization for clearinghouse activities qPeriod l 2001 ~ 2005 qBudget l $ 25 Million q Strategy l Progressive implement

Main project plan - phase 1 qPhase 1: 2002~2003 qEstablishing nationwide distribution network l Extend network and regional centers 3 centers planned l Make partnership between data provider agency and centers l Establishment institutional, and technical framework

Main project plan - phase 2 qPhase 2: 2002~2005 qCompleting distribution network and extending services l Provide wide level of contents & methods l Extend the data provider agency l Integrated network for data providers, central & regional centers l Establishing of digital geo-spatial lib qActivating international cooperation l PCGIAP co-work

18 qInternational Cooperation l PCGIAP’s APSDI cleaning house pilot project Establishing baseline policy, data sharing criteria Adopting and develop ISO/TC211 metadata Close discussion with PCGIAP member countries l Running APSDI clearinghouse ’02-’03 : Pilot project member countries ’03-’04 : Extend to full member countries

Major Schedule qPhase 1: ~ l Operating central information center and regional center l Pre-operation Data search, access and distribution qPhase 2 : 2003 ~ 2005 l Merging data provider to the regional center l Complete national distribution network

Major schedule for APSDI clearinghouse qPhase 1: ~ l Completing pilot project l Establishing baseline policy, data sharing criteria l Adopting and develop ISO/TC211 metadata l Build web page qLayers available l Vector : Administration boundary, Transportation, Hydrography l Raster : DEM, Landcover, Vegetation l Scale : 1,000,000 l Format : DXF, DWG qPhase 2: ~ l Cooperate with PCGIAP
